What Is the Grass Type?
Grass-type Pokémon are inspired by nature, plants, and ecosystems. They typically use moves involving leaves, vines, spores, and natural energy. Many Grass Pokémon are known for:
- Healing moves like Leech Seed and Giga Drain
- Status effects such as Sleep Powder and Stun Spore
- Defensive or stall-based strategies
- Gradual damage over time
Despite these strengths, Grass types are among the most countered types in the game.
Grass Type Weaknesses Explained
Grass-type Pokémon are weak against five main types. Each weakness is based on logical or natural interactions.
1. Fire Type (Strongest Counter)
Fire is the most dangerous weakness for Grass Pokémon.
- Fire destroys plant-based organisms quickly
- Grass Pokémon are usually not resistant to heat
- Fire-type moves deal super effective damage (2×)
Common moves:
- Flamethrower
- Fire Blast
- Overheat
👉 Fire Pokémon like Charizard and Arcanine are classic Grass counters.
2. Flying Type
Flying-type Pokémon can easily pressure Grass types.
- Aerial attacks bypass grounded defenses
- Grass Pokémon often have low speed
- Flying moves provide strong burst damage
Common moves:
- Brave Bird
- Air Slash
- Hurricane
👉 Fast attackers like Talonflame excel in this matchup.
3. Bug Type
Bug types also exploit Grass weaknesses effectively.
- In nature, insects consume plants
- Bug moves are naturally effective against Grass
- Many Bug Pokémon are fast and aggressive
Common moves:
- X-Scissor
- Bug Buzz
- U-turn
👉 Pokémon like Scizor can quickly overwhelm Grass types.
4. Poison Type
Poison is another strong disadvantage for Grass Pokémon.
- Toxic substances damage plant cells
- Poison often causes damage over time
- Grass types struggle to resist status effects
Common moves:
- Sludge Bomb
- Toxic
- Poison Jab
👉 Gengar is a strong example of a Poison-type counter.
5. Ice Type
Ice attacks are highly effective against Grass Pokémon.
- Freezing temperatures damage plant life
- Ice moves often deal heavy burst damage
- Many Ice Pokémon are strong special attackers
Common moves:
- Ice Beam
- Blizzard
- Icicle Crash
👉 Weavile and Lapras are strong Ice-type threats.

Grass Type Strengths (For Balance)
Even with weaknesses, Grass types have strong advantages:
- Effective against Water types
- Effective against Ground types
- Access to healing and recovery moves
- Strong status control abilities
This makes them valuable in defensive and support roles.
